Budhna

Budhna is a village located in Ghansaur tehsil of Seoni district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 21km away from sub-district headquarter Ghansaur (tehsildar office) and 121km away from district headquarter Seoni. As per 2009 stats, Budhera is the gram panchayat of Budhna village.

About Budhna

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Budhna is 496213. The village spans a total geographical area of 190.38 hectares. Jabalpur is nearest town to Budhna village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 91km away.

Population of Budhna

According to the 2011 Census, Budhna has a total population of about 333, with approximately 171 males and 162 females. The sex ratio is around 947 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 41 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 329. The overall literacy rate is approximately 45.35%, with male literacy at about 57.31% and female literacy near 32.72%. There are around 79 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Budhna's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 333 171 162
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 41 21 20
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 329 168 161
Literate Population 151 98 53
Illiterate Population 182 73 109

Connectivity of Budhna

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Budhna. As per the 2011 stats, Budhna had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
